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

CatBoostRegressor/CatBoostClassifier doesn't have attribute n_features_in_ required by sklearn. #1363

Closed
ogabrielluiz opened this issue Jul 20, 2020 · 2 comments

Comments

@ogabrielluiz
Copy link

Problem: As of version 0.23.1 scikit-learn implements an attribute called n_features_in_ which is required to create pipelines (E.g StackingRegressor). At the moment it is not possible to use Catboost within it because of that.
catboost version: 0.23.2
Operating System: Ubuntu 20.04
CPU: Ryzen 7 1800x
GPU: GTX 1070

@Evgueni-Petrov-aka-espetrov
Copy link
Contributor

Many thanks for reporting this issue!
We will fix it in one of the next releases.

arcadia-devtools pushed a commit that referenced this issue Aug 13, 2020
MLTOOLS-5055

ref:bf0d6f570e55829918a1b5050deec234a6d55dd8
@kizill
Copy link
Member

kizill commented Aug 27, 2020

Released in 0.24.1

@kizill kizill closed this as completed Aug 27, 2020
arcadia-devtools pushed a commit that referenced this issue Jan 18, 2022
MLTOOLS-5055

ref:bf0d6f570e55829918a1b5050deec234a6d55dd8
robot-piglet pushed a commit that referenced this issue Jan 15, 2023
MLTOOLS-5055

ref:bf0d6f570e55829918a1b5050deec234a6d55dd8
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

3 participants